HomeMy WebLinkAboutcc3 4 08WASHLandfillletterPLACEHOLDER ON THE AGENDA DRAFT LETTER COMING LATER City Council Date: 3.4.08 REGULAR Item: 7 ITEM: Direction on draft letter of response to the MPCA regarding remediation alternatives at the Washington County Landfill SUBMITTED BY: Susan Hoyt, City Administrator SUMMARY AND ACTION REQUESTED: The City Council is being asked to review material to Include in a letter to the PCA during the comment period on the proposed options for remediating contamination at the Washington County Landfill. A PCA public meeting on the options was held on February 21, 2008. The city council has discussed this topic at prior city council meetings and workshops. To date the city council’s position has been to ask for a permanent solution including the ‘truck and dig’ option with or without a plasma burner. This position is based upon the city’s and citizens’ history with re-emerging contamination at the landfill, which is on a gravel pit and where garbage was dumped and in the water. If more review of a letter is needed, the city council may finalize its comments at its March 11, 2008 meeting. Legislation on this topic is in flux. A draft letter will be prepared after more is known about the legislative status of the bill. SUGGESTED MOTION FOR CONSIDERATION Move to provide a letter of comment which clearly asks for a permanent solution at the Washington County Landfill and which recognizes the history of contamination and remediation solutions at the site.
